Speakers

Damian Chandler

Pastor Damian Chandler, born in Toronto and raised in Barbados, encountered Jesus at 16 through the prayers of believers meeting in his home. He has since served in churches across the U.S.—from Seattle to Huntsville to Sacramento—and will soon serve as associate youth director for the South Central Conference, planting a new church in Nashville. A gifted storyteller, he authored The Crooked Christmas Tree and I Am Jon, inspiring many through his simple, relatable view of the gospel. Above all, Damian treasures his family—his wife Tanzy, and their children Zoe, Salem, and Levi.

Ivana Mendez

Ivana Mendez holds an MA in Education from the Matej Bel University, Faculty of Humanities in Slovakia and an MA in Theology (New Testament) from the Friedensau Adventist University (Newbold College). She worked as a teacher, translator, project manager in the Slovak Bible Society, pastor in the South England Conference of Seventh-day Adventists and in the Scottish Mission. Currently, she is a lecturer of biblical languages and in biblical studies at Newbold College of Higher Education.

Pricing

The final cost of attending the European Adventist Youth Congress depends on your country of residence, as you will be attending as part of a country delegation. Some countries may offer additional trip experiences. Check with your Union or Conference Youth Director for the specific details and final pricing in your country.

If you live in a country that is outside of Europe, please contact us to register.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will there be translation at AYC26?

The plenary sessions will be in English, but translation will be offered into the following languages: Bulgarian, Czech, French, German, Italian, Portuguese, Romanian, Spanish.

What do I need to bring for accommodation at the venue?

The registration package (option A) with accommodation includes sleeping in tents in the sleeping halls at the venue.

What do I do with my valuables?

We won’t have a specific place for participants to keep their valuables. So we recommend you take essentials with you: purse with money, passport, and phone, and take these with you at all times. As a congress participant, you are responsible for your belongings.

I would like to get baptised at the congress. What do I need to do?

Sabbath morning will be very special because we plan to have a baptism ceremony. If you would like to get baptized then, please contact your union/conference youth director.
